While it is a slow cooker too, it’s also so much more. The Ninja® Cooking System with Auto-iQ™ is actually four appliances built into one a slow cooker. It can be used like a stove top for searing and sautéing, a steamer and an oven for baking.

I love that it can do so many different things. Often times, multi cookers do one thing awesome and a few things okay. So far everything I have tried in my Ninja Cooking System has been great.

One of the reasons it works so well compared to traditional slow cookers (which typically only heat from the side), is that Ninja’s Triple Fusion Heat® brings bottom, side and steam heat together for easy one-pot meals.

The reason these recipes are so easy to throw together is because of the built in Auto-iQ™ Technology, which features more than 80 pre-programmed recipes (featured in the cookbook). You can choose from quick meals, layered bowls, poached infusions and grains.
